Stem Cell Delivery Methods: Opportunities and Challenges

There are many approaches to cell delivery, each with its own unique aspect and subtle pros and cons. Instead of solely looking at the objective results, the efficacy of these delivery systems should be evaluated on a case-by-case basis. Optimal cell therapy depends on successful delivery into the area of need, engraftment of a sufficient concentration of cells and prolonged survival of the transplanted cells. While cells have been delivered and a biological effect has been observed, the optimal stem/precursor cell to use, the number of cells required, the timing of transplantation post-infarction, and the optimal cellular milieu and delivery route have yet to be determined.
